Juventus eyes move for Real Madrid’s left-back

Juventus is reportedly considering a major move in the upcoming transfer window to boost its defensive line. The club has set its sights on Ferland Mendy, the left-back currently at Real Madrid.

According to reports from Spain, shared by Elgoldigital, Juventus could begin negotiations with the “Los Blancos” as early as January.

Mendy, who has been an important part of Real Madrid’s defense in recent years, is no longer a guaranteed starter under coach Xabi Alonso. This change in status might prompt Madrid to offer him for a fee close to €20 million—a price Juventus could find manageable.

Ferland Mendy – A valuable asset for Juventus’ defense

The French fullback has proven himself both defensively and offensively, providing stability at the back while pushing forward on the left flank. Although he has lost his regular starting role to David Alaba and Antonio Rudiger, Mendy remains a high-quality defender.

His international experience and skill set could add depth and resilience to Juventus’ backline. For some time now, Juventus has been searching for a reliable left-back to serve as a strong alternative to Andrea Cambiaso.

Bringing Mendy on board might offer the team a solid defensive option, especially critical during tough European matches. However, the success of this potential transfer depends not only on financial terms but also on Real Madrid’s willingness to negotiate.

With the January transfer window approaching, Juventus faces a crucial decision. The club must weigh the benefits of signing Mendy against interest from other teams. If the deal materializes, it could prove a significant boost for the Bianconeri.

Mendy’s experience and quality would be invaluable as Juventus looks to strengthen its squad for the demanding second half of the season.

For now, the negotiations remain tentative, and the coming months could bring important developments regarding Mendy’s future. Fans and analysts alike will be watching closely to see if Juventus can secure this key defensive reinforcement.
